MARSHALL, Ind. —
Brandon Dorman and Joe Fidler combined for 37 points and six 3-pointers Saturday night as visiting Cloverdale defeated Turkey Run 63-45 in boys high school basketball.
It was the 714th coaching win for Pat Rady of Cloverdale, the leader among active Indiana coaches.
Jeff Woods had a game-high 31 points for the Warriors.
